/* Kinoli Has Style */

body {
	margin:0;
	padding:0;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:#818181;
	text-align:center;
	width: 702px;
	margin-left:auto;
	margin-right:auto;
}

/************************************** default fonts *************************************/
h2 { /* headlines */
	margin:0;
	font-size:10px;
	text-indent:11px;
	color:#38A8AA;
	border-top:#38A8AA 1px solid;
	border-bottom:#38A8AA 1px solid;
	width:100%;
	height:24px;
	line-height:23px;
}
h2 img{ vertical-align:text-top; }
h3 { /* green text */
	margin:0;
	color:#53B669;
	font-size:10px;
	line-height: 15px;
	
}
h4 { /* white text */
	margin:0;
	font-size:10px;
	line-height: 16px;
	color:#FFFFFF;
	font-weight:normal;
}
h5 { /* copyright */
	margin:0;
	font-weight:normal;
	font-size:10px;
}
h1,h6,code {
	margin:0;
	padding:0;
}
a, a:visited, a:link {
	font-weight:bold;
	color:#F50000;
  	text-decoration: none;
}
a:hover{
  text-decoration: underline;
}


/************************************** News Links *************************************/

a.newsLink:link {
	color: #818181;
	text-decoration: underline;
	font-weight: bold;
}

a.newsLink:visited {
	color: #818181;
	text-decoration: underline;
	font-weight: bold;
}

a.newsLink:hover {
	color: #818181;
	text-decoration: none;
	font-weight: bold;

}



a.emailLink:link {
	color: #FFFFFF;
	text-decoration: underline;
	font-weight:normal;
}

a.emailLink:visited {
	color: #FFFFFF;
	text-decoration: underline;
	font-weight:normal;
}

a.emailLink:hover {
	color: #FFFFFF;
	text-decoration: none;
	font-weight:normal;

}





/************************************** main container holds all the main div areas *************************************/
#container {
	position:relative;
	text-align:left;
	top: 29px;
}

/************************************** Main Div Areas *************************************/
#header {
	position:relative;
	z-index:10;
	height:122px;
	border-top:#38A8AA 3px solid;
}
#latest {
	position:relative;
	z-index:9;
	width:682px;
	left: 10px;
	height:346px;
}
#recent, #project_info {
	position:relative;
	z-index:8;
	width:682px;
	left: 10px;
	height:566px;
}
#brands {
	position:relative;
	z-index:7;
	width:682px;
	left: 10px;
	height:210px;
}
#email {
	position:relative;
	z-index:6;
	width:682px;
	left: 10px;
	height:217px;
}
#footer {
	position:relative;
	z-index:11;
	height:75px;
	border-top:#38A8AA 3px solid;
}

/************************************** Header *************************************/
#logo {
	position:absolute;
	left:20px;
	top:21px;
}
#seriously_fun {
	position:absolute;
	right:25px;
	top:-8.5px;
}

/************************************** Latest Project *************************************/
#latest div#project {
	position:absolute;
	top:0;
	width:328px;
}
#project div#image {
	position:absolute;
	top:52px;
	left:11px;
}
#project div#title {
	position:relative;
	top: 256px;
	left:11px;
}
#project div#links {
	position:relative;
	font-size:10px;
	top:256px;
	left:11px;
}

/************************************** Latest News *************************************/
#latest div#news {
	position:absolute;
	top:0;
	width:328px;
	right: 0;
	font-size:10px;
	font-weight:normal;
	line-height: 16px;
}
#news div#scroll {
	position:absolute;
	left:11px;
	top:49px;
}

#latest div#content {
	position:absolute; 
	left:0; 
	top:0;
	padding-right:10px;	
	width: 295px;
}
#latest div#track {
	position:absolute; 
	left:309px; 
	top:0px; 
	z-index:3;
}
#latest div#drag {
	position:absolute; 
	left:309px; 
	top:0px; 
	z-index:4; 
	cursor:pointer;
}
#latest div#track img {
	height: 234px;
	width: 19px;
}
#latest div#mask {
	position : absolute; 
	left : 0; 
	top: 0;
	width:295px; 
	height:235px; 
	overflow:hidden; 
	z-index:6;
}
#latest div#return {
	position:absolute;
	top:293px;
	right: 0;
	font-size:10px;
}

/************************************** Recent Work *************************************/
#recent div#col1 {
	position:absolute;
	top:50px;
	left: 11px;
}
#recent div#col2 {
	position:absolute;
	top:50px;
	left: 185px;
}
#recent div#col3 {
	position:absolute;
	top:50px;
	left: 358px;
}
#recent div#col4 {
	position:absolute;
	top:50px;
	left: 530px;
}

#recent div#title {
	position:relative;
	top: 5px;
	left:0;
}
#recent div#links {
	position:relative;
	font-size:10px;
	top:5px;
	left:0;
}
#recent div#item2 {
	position:absolute;
	top:173px;
}
#recent div#item3 {
	position:absolute;
	top:338px;
}

/************************************** Project Info *************************************/
#recent div#image_details {
	position:absolute;
	top:50px;
	left: 11px;
}
#recent div#details {
	position:absolute;
	top:50px;
	left: 368px;
	font-size:10px;
	font-weight:normal;
	line-height: 16px;
	width: 295px;
}
#recent div#return {
	position:absolute;
	top:283px;
	right: 0;
	font-size:10px;
}

/************************************** Brands Served *************************************/
#brands div#list {
	position:absolute;
	top:40px;
	width:100%;
	font-size:10px;
	line-height:28px;
}
#brands div#col1 {
	position:absolute;
	left:10px;
}
#brands div#col2 {
	position:absolute;
	left:183px;
}
#brands div#col3 {
	position:absolute;
	left:357px;
}
#brands div#col4 {
	position:absolute;
	left:529px;
}

/************************************** Email *************************************/
#email div#subhead {
	position:absolute;
	top: 45px;
	left: 11px;
}
#email div#col1 {
	position:absolute;
	top: 100px;
	left: 11px;
	font-size:10px;
	font-weight:normal;
	text-align:center;
}
#email div#col2 {
	position:absolute;
	top: 100px;
	left: 175px;
	font-size:10px;
	font-weight:normal;
	text-align:center;
}

#email div#bubble2 {
	position:absolute;
	top: 89px;
	left: 164px;
	font-size:10px;
	font-weight:normal;
}

#email div#bubble1 {
	position:absolute;
	top: 89px;
	left: 0px;
	font-size:10px;
	font-weight:normal;
}

#email div#form {
	position:absolute;
	top: 45px;
	left: 358px;
	
}

/************************************** Footer *************************************/
#footer div#copyright {
	position:absolute;
	top:8px;
}

.greyText{
  margin:0;
	font-size:10px;
	line-height: 16px;
	color:#818181;
	font-weight:normal;
}

